The Keller DCX-38 VG Level Logger is an autonomous instrument for recording water level with a high resolution
and full scale ranges as low as 0,5 mWC / 50 mbar. It features a rugged, gold-plated ceramic diaphragm for outstanding
long-term stability and stainless steel housing with user serviceable battery for long service life.
The internal electronics of the DCX-38 VG employ the latest microprocessor technology, resulting in high accuracy and
resolution for pressure measurements. The use of non-volatile memory for data storage ensures high data security.
The DCX-38 VG is based upon a relative pressure sensor and is designed for submersible deployment. Through the use of
a vented cable, correction for atmospheric pressure variations is automatic. Therefore, the expense of deploying additional
instruments for monitoring barometric pressure is avoided.
